Ingredients:
2/3 cup sugar |
1/2 cup cornstarch |
1/8 teaspoon salt |
3 cups whole milk |
3 egg yolks, beaten |
2 tablespoons margarine |
1 teaspoon vanilla extract |
1/8 teaspoon freshly grated nutmeg |
2 large bananas, peeled and cut into 1/4-inch slices |
1 1/2 teaspoons lemon juice |
1 baked 9-inch pastry shell |
3/4 cup whipping cream |
2 tablespoons sifted powdered sugar |
1/4 cup large shreds coconut, toasted |
Directions:
1. Combine first 3 ingredients in a heavy saucepan. Gradually add milk, stirring well. Bring to a boil over medium heat, stirring constantly. 2. Stir one-fourth of hot mixture into egg yolks; add to remaining hot mixture, stirring constantly. Cook 2 minutes or until thick. Remove from heat, and transfer to a bowl; stir in margarine, vanilla, and nutmeg. Cool completely. 3. Sprinkle banana slices with lemon juice; stir into egg mixture. Spoon mixture into baked pastry shell. Cover with plastic wrap; chill thoroughly. 4. Beat whipping cream until foamy; gradually add powdered sugar, beating until soft peaks form. Spread whipped cream over chilled banana filling. Top with coconut. |
